Eyre Arms Hassop, Bakewell DE45 1NS, Tel 01629 640390

Formally a farmstead and 17th Century Coaching Inn, The Old Eyre Arms is now a Family owned & run pub restaurant. Your hosts Lynne, Nick & Sam Smith are devoted to retaining the character and friendly atmosphere of this unique unspoilt hostelry, cheery logs fires warm its charming oak beamed rooms, with there low ceiling, oak settles, long case clock & old pictures.
